Is Deluxe Market clean?

Deluxe Market is currently Pass from Chicago Department of Public Health, from an inspection on June 26, 2026. No critical violations were recorded at that visit. On Cooked's ladder that reads clean πŸ˜‡.

What did inspectors find at Deluxe Market?

Nothing was written up at the most recent inspection on June 26, 2026. A clean sheet like this is the best possible result β€” no violations of any severity were recorded.

When was Deluxe Market last inspected?

Deluxe Market has 3 inspections on record going back to April 13, 2026.

June 26, 2026 Pass License Re-Inspection Β· 0 failed findings

How Chicago grades restaurants

Chicago does not use letter grades. Every inspection ends in one of three official results: Pass, Pass with Conditions, or Fail. Pass with Conditions means violations were found but corrected on the spot or under a deadline β€” the restaurant is open, with homework. A Fail means serious violations went uncorrected, and it usually brings a re-inspection within days. Chicago also flags β€œpriority” violations, the ones most likely to actually make someone sick. Cooked reads Pass as clean, Pass with Conditions as mid, and Fail as cooked, and shows the itemized violations behind each result.
